What is Agentic AI?
An AI agent is a system that can perceive its environment, make decisions, and take actions to achieve specific goals without constant human oversight. In practice, this means software that can monitor your CRM for stale leads, draft personalized follow-up emails, schedule calls, and update the pipeline — all without a human pressing a button. The Shift in Software Architecture
For software architecture, this changes the paradigm from request-response applications to event-driven, agent-orchestrated systems. Instead of users triggering every action, agents monitor data streams, detect patterns, and initiate workflows proactively. This requires a different approach to backend design: message queues, tool-use APIs, and robust guardrails become essential infrastructure.
Business Implications and ROI
The business implications are significant. Companies that integrate agents into their workflows report 30-50% reductions in manual processing time for routine operations like data entry, report generation, and customer support triage. However, the technology is not without risks. Poorly designed agents can make costly mistakes, which is why human-in-the-loop oversight remains critical for high-stakes decisions.
